Output 55ec8258f534c933584540481ca9ab5345885366cf4a0cc78760fb075df7b920:14

value
29823030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f98d36e230e51bcae23b0152dd9e0425441087e OP_EQUAL
address
MGcdWBcH3tademF46TL3qDUpW8PbTmDsoK
transaction
55ec8258f534c933584540481ca9ab5345885366cf4a0cc78760fb075df7b920
spent
true